If you have holdings across various exchanges xrb at bitgrail, btc at gdax, req at binance. Fetching live stock market data with python and alphavantage. One of the toughest things to do as a new developer is to assemble an online portfolio what should i say. Build a stock market web app with python and django 4.
Track a portfolio of equity securities with python. Download for macos to build from source, or for windows version, scroll down for instructions. We will use 2 simple excel features to achieve this web queries and vlookup first, lets put a tabular format for our portfolio. The 5 best investment tracking apps consumerism commentary.
An efficient portfolio is defined as a portfolio with minimal risk for a given return, or, equivalently, as the portfolio with the highest return for a given level of risk. I definitely recommend portfolio slicer jonathan schon. For a holistic approach to picking stocks, or conducting analysis. The portfolio is dinamical in the sense that each day computes the risk measures taking into account the past 200 observations. Track your personal stock portfolios and watch lists, and automatically determine your day gain and total gain at yahoo finance. A portfolio management software allows you to keep track of all the stocks you have invested and the current value of the portfolio. Top 5 cryptocurrency portfolio trackers for everyday use. Jul 06, 2018 would you like to spend next 5 minutes learning how to create an mutual fund tracker excel sheet. Would you like to spend next 5 minutes learning how to create an excel sheet to track your mutual fund portfolio. Backtest portfolio asset allocation portfolio visualizer.
This is a very basic python script to track market stocks and manage a portfolio. The problem though is that some projects are either too simple for an. Conveniently access all the latest research from equitymaster on stocks you own. Dec 18, 2017 matplotlib is a python library for making publication quality plots using a syntax familiar to matlab users. Create an excel investment portfolio tracker template learn. Im new to programming and am trying to get better by writing useful things. One of the best stock portfolio tracking apps on the app. Output formats include pdf, postscript, svg, and png, as well as screen display. Assess your stock positions price, daychange, gain. Jan 08, 2019 these days accurate data is most precious asset for financial market participants.
Documentation for portfolio slicer excel workbook and scripts. Stockmarketeye can also create a csv file in this format. Portfolio slicer is an amazing tool to track your investments and build your own portfolios using excel. Ive spent most of the time on my primary project determining our global rollout plan and related business intelligence. Zoom investment portfolio manager a simple to use manager for your investments in stocks, shares and funds.
What are good python packages for portfolio analysis of. It can be improved a lot and i am going to do add features myself, feel free to download it and modify. Coin stats powerful new interface and features is a worth number one in our list. I dont do complicated transactions, but still, nothing could really satisfy me. What financial python libraries are available for portfolio.
The same source code archive can also be used to build the windows and mac versions, and is the starting point for ports to all other platforms. Whenever you download new data and load into excel, you inevitably need to modify some formulas and validate for errors. The user can ask the program to download stocks from yahoo finance by typing the tickers associated to the stocks and then assign the relative weights. My plan is to basically just write a bunch of programs with increasing difficulty and breadth and document my progress. It can be improved a lot and i am going to do add features myself, feel free to download it and modify it as you wish. For premium subscribers only track your portfolio on the go with the mobile friendly version of the. Track and manage your stock portfolio of euronext shares in realtime 15 delay.
Your portfolio might include any combination of financial assets, such as stocks, bonds, mutual. Would you like to spend next 5 minutes learning how to create an mutual fund tracker excel sheet. When i call the getsale function with option 2 under the main function i always get highest selling stock is with a 0 profit margin. Build a stock market web app with python and django udemy. Recently i was working with a not so old python code written less than a year ago that i saw it is not. I am proficient with python, but i do not have anything to show for it.
You may need to install the csv module but i dont think you do. Make a live, updatable mutual fund portfolio tracker for indian markets to keep track of your investments using this example. Ability to test your trading ideas before you trade. You can create csv files via most spreadsheet applications such as microsoft excel or calc. It does not appear that the dividends receipts i previously entered over the years have been added to the investment to provide roi. This includes trading ratios, and peer comparison, not just stock price tracking. This project is a gui application which stores different data in the form of records ganeshkavhar 20200320. I use ystockquote module to track prices but there are two versions of it with different names for the functions. Download market data from open source ideally module. This portfolio backtesting tool allows you to construct one or more portfolios based on the selected mutual funds, etfs, and stocks. During this time, ive probably used 10 or so different portfolio trackers, but nothing met my needs.
To understand project portfolio management, well break the term down into its parts. A program for financial portfolio management, analysis and optimisation. I think im pretty close but missing something somewhere. A project that ive always had, was to improve on my stock portfolio tracking spreadsheets. Here are the survey results in order of their top choice rankings. As it relates to ppm, a project is an individual effort to create a discrete product or service in a bounded amount of time. But the euphoria of just learning can be replaced by the hunger for handson projects.
It has been several months since i wrote those, largely due to the fact that i relocated my family to seattle to join amazon in november. As it relates to ppm, a project is an individual effort to create a. For this assignment, you will write a program for keeping track of the value of a group of stocks. You can transfer your investment data into stockmarketeye via commaseparated values csv files. Portfolio management of multiple strategies using python. For most unix systems, you must download and compile the source code.
I created this sample portfolio tracker in excel that draws live data from the coinmarketcap api and refreshes on demand. To find the portfolio that best suits your needs, we need a little bit of information from you first. Welcome to equitymasters intelligent portfolio tracker. I want to build a portfolio, and in the process, increase my skill in python. Learning the basics of python is a wonderful experience. The stocks feature is only available for office 365 subscribers. There is no monetary amount set forth in any of the previous dividend additions. These days accurate data is most precious asset for financial market participants. The best online tools to track your investments forbes. Apr 16, 2018 my two most recent blog posts were about scaling analytical insights with python. Your portfolio might include any combination of financial assets, such as. The 10 best crypto portfolio tracker apps november 2019. Track the value of your stock portfolio by inputting the initial purchase and cost basis data, and a current quote for each stock. There is no longer any section that gives you total roi.
Automatically download stock price data from yahoo finance. The flexibility and the ability to create unlimited own reports for your portfolios makes portfolio slicer to the best portfolio tracker i have had. We will walk through a simple python script to retrieve, analyze, and visualize data on different cryptocurrencies. Numpy the fundamental library needed for scientific and financial computing with python as it contains a powerful ndimensional array object, advanced array slicing methods, c. Mutual fund portfolio tracker using excel download and. Aug 10, 2017 to understand project portfolio management, well break the term down into its parts. Merge the overall dataframe with the adj close start of year dataframe for ytd tracking of tickers. The store management in python is a simple project developed using python. Portfolio tracking software download give your investments the attention they deserve. Matplotlib is a python library for making publication quality plots using a syntax familiar to matlab users. The template will show you the gain or loss for each stock between the original purchase and its current market value.
The goal of this article is to provide an easy introduction to cryptocurrency analysis using python. Assess your stock positions price, daychange, gain, gain%, value, weight% with one command. Contribute to khrystophportfoliotracker development by creating an account on github. Apr 06, 2017 there are various python libraries which are available for finance and trading activities. Python bibliotheca python resources for teachers and students. When i call the getsale function with option 2 under the main function i always get highest selling stock is with a. Im making a portfolio tracker using pandas remote data function, however, im running into a problem passing in multiple stock names and tickers. Coin stats, which was already a highlyrated top 5 crypto portfolio tracker in our last. The getsale function should calculate this value for each stock in the portfolio, and return the stock symbol with the highest expected sale value. If you dont have a office 365 account, feel free to use the link affiliated link below to sign up.
Track stocks, funds, etfs and more from around the world. Pandas is an open source library provides easy to use data structure and data analysis tools for python. I find the new msn portfolio tracker to be cumbersome and rather useless. In the past, i downloaded historical price data from yahoo finance and used index. Welcome to my portfolio now you can link brokers and trade. Its normal to want to build projects, hence the need for project ideas. Aug 20, 2017 the goal of this article is to provide an easy introduction to cryptocurrency analysis using python. I have an excel file with stock transactions 4 accounts, multicurrency. It is not very complex and i feel like im not really improving my skills since it uses mostly beginner concepts, but id welcome any comments. It can be improved a lot and i am going to do add features myself, feel free to download. Many investors have a portfolio of stocks or mutual funds.
In this tutorial, we will be learning how to build the a investment portfolio tracker from a blank workbook in excel. In the financial world a portfolio is a collection of investments. You can analyze and backtest portfolio returns, risk characteristics, style exposures, and drawdowns. I would like to create separate data frames by the company name and im attempting to use kwargs, but am a little fuzzy on how it works. Automate your stock portfolio research with python in 6 minutes. As algorithmic traders, our portfolio is made up of strategies or rules and each of these manages one or more instruments. Python jupyter notebook stock portfolio historical tracker python. There are various python libraries which are available for finance and trading activities. Ive created an excel crypto portfolio tracker that. In the process, we will uncover an interesting trend in how these volatile markets behave, and how they are evolving.